Indefinite Leave to Remain (ILR) grants permission to live in the UK without time restrictions. Qualifying routes include long residence, family visas, work visas, and other eligible categories.

Applicants must usually meet continuous residence requirements, pass the Life in the UK test where applicable, demonstrate English language ability, and show they have no unspent criminal convictions that would affect good character.

The specific requirements depend on the route through which you are applying. Absences from the UK, changes in immigration status, and prior refusals can affect eligibility. Seek tailored advice before submitting an application.
